Ingredients

 
Milk - 1/2 cup
 
Egg - 1
 
Catsup - 1 tablespoon
 
Prepared mustard - 1 tablespoon
 
Pepper - 1/8 teaspoon
 
Soft white-bread crumbs - 1 cup
 
Ground ham - 1 lb
 
Ground veal - 1/2 lb
 
Onion - 2 tablespoons, finely chopped
 
Parsley - 1 tablespoon, chopped
 
For fruit glaze:
 
Fruits for salad - 1 can (8-3/4 oz)
 
Light-brown sugar - 1/4 cup, firmly packed
 
Cider vinegar - 2 tablespoons

Directions

GETTING READY
1. Preheat oven to 350F.

MAKING
2. In large bowl, combine milk, egg, catsup, mustard and pepper and beat until well blended.
3. Stir in bread crumbs and let mixture stand several minutes.
4. Mix well adding ham, veal, onion and parsley.
5. In shallow baking pan, shape meat into loaf about 8 inches long and 4 inches wide.
6. Bake ham loaf, uncovered, for 30 minutes.
To make Fruit Glaze:
7. Into a small saucepan drain syrup from fruit and bring it to boiling adding brown sugar and vinegar stirring.
8. Add fruit reduce heat and simmer for 5 minutes.
9. Remove saucepan from heat.
10. Remove ham loaf from oven.
11. Pour glaze over loaf, arranging the fruit attractively on top.
12. Bake ham loaf 30 minutes longer.
13. With wide spatula, remove ham loaf to a warm platter.
14. Over top of the loaf spoon glaze from pan.

SERVING
15. Serve with cabbage wedges, if desired and pass Mustard Sauce separately.
